go for the freshest tyres you can. check the date stamp (which many dealers change). it's a 4 digit code embossed in an oval on the sidewall of the tyre. the first 2 digits are the week it was produced and the second 2 are the year.
example:
2208 would mean the tyres were made in the 22nd week of 2008. DO NOT buy a tyre which was made any later than 4008 otherwise they'll have a very short life as they will have started getting harder than what is acceptable for daily useage.
